在国产大算力芯片迈入大规模产业化落地的关键周期,头部玩家的座次正在重排不断实现自我突破。 近日,胡润研究院在北京亦庄发布《2025胡润中国人工智能企业50强》。在这份衡量中国AI产业成色 的重磅榜单中,沐曦集成电路(下称"沐曦")以2500亿元人民币的企业价值位列第三,并被官方定义 为"中国首批实现全流程国产化的高端GPU(图形处理器)企业"。 软件生态"即插即用":MACA开源一年调用超1300万次 硬件是底座,软件则是护城河。为了打破算力领域的软件垄断,沐曦自研了原生兼容主流生态的软件栈 MXMACA。 施淑珏透露,MXMACA已于2025年2月正式开源,在不到一年的时间里,该平台已积累了超过15万用 户,API调用次数突破1300万次。通过与高校合作,沐曦的软件生态已覆盖超过10万名大学生开发者。 "原生兼容意味着AI应用可以几乎零成本地迁移到沐曦平台上,实现'即插即用'。"施淑珏分享道。 "1+6+X"策略:助力AI赋能千行百业金融领域已现"三期复购" 在应用落地层面,沐曦提出了"1+6+X"的行业布局方案。其中,"6"涵盖了金融、医疗、能源、教科 研、交通及大文娱六大垂直行业;"X"则指向具身智能、 ...

Summary of Conference Call on Huawei's Super Node and Domestic AI Chip Market Industry Overview - The conference call discusses the domestic AI chip market, focusing on Huawei's 384 Super Node and its competitive landscape against international players like NVIDIA [1][2][8]. Key Points and Arguments - **Huawei 384 Super Node**: - Utilizes high-speed interconnect and optical module technology, enhancing cost-effectiveness and deployment certainty in inference scenarios, serving as a domestic alternative to NVIDIA's Nvlink bottleneck [1][2]. - Supports SP8, providing superior performance in inference tasks compared to many domestic cards lacking this feature [2]. - **Domestic AI Chip Companies**: - Companies like Moer, Muxi, and Suiyuan are narrowing the gap with international leaders through technological advancements, with expectations to increase market share by 2026 [1][4]. - New products from these companies, such as Moer S5000 and Muxi C600, are expected to meet the demands of major internet companies, enhancing their competitive position [4]. - **Market Demand and Supply**: - The demand for domestic computing cards is not limited to internet companies but extends to telecom operators, financial institutions, and state-owned enterprises, indicating a supply-demand imbalance [3][16]. - The market is projected to focus on 2026 valuations, with optimism surrounding the growth of domestic graphics cards [3][13]. - **High-Density Super Point Solutions**: - Companies like Haiguang are developing high-density, high-performance super point solutions, such as a silent liquid cooling solution supporting up to 660 cards, to improve overall computing efficiency [5][6]. - **GPGPU Architecture Development**: - Domestic GPGPU architecture is evolving, with companies like Huawei Ascend transitioning to GPGPU to reduce interconnect development risks [7]. - The integration of DSA functions into GPUs by manufacturers like Moer indicates a trend towards technological convergence [7]. - **Future Market Dynamics**: - The competitive landscape is expected to become more complex by 2026, with new product launches and testing processes for internet companies [10][12]. - Despite the anticipated changes, the overall market structure is expected to remain stable, with Huawei leading, followed by Cambricon and Haiguang [10]. Additional Important Insights - **Inference Demand Growth**: - The increasing demand for inference capabilities, especially in the context of the multi-modal era, is driving the need for domestic computing cards [9][12]. - **AI Application Revenue**: - Significant growth in AI application revenues is anticipated, with estimates for companies like Keling reaching $200 million in 2025 [10]. - **Comparison with U.S. Market**: - The U.S. market is dominated by a few major clients, while China's demand is diversified across numerous long-tail customers, indicating a robust growth potential for domestic computing cards [16].
